Thought Provoking Questions 1. You have been asked to prioritize the requirements of a clinical documentation system. It has already been determined that ease, usability and dependability are priorities, what else would you include in the system requirements?
15
Thought Provoking Questions 2. You have been asked to design a test scenario for a new CIS. What are some of the details you would test? Who would you involve? 3. You are asked about a diagnosis that you are unfamiliar with. Where would you start looking for information? How would you determine the validity of the information?
